Default "Right click Send to Mail Recipient" uses Hotmail instead of O

When I right click on any file on the Desktop or Explorer, and click Send To,
then Mail Recipient, instead of Outlook Express opening a new message with
the file attached, Internet Explorer launches and attempts to log me in to my
Hotmail account to send that file via e-mail.

I have checked in Internet Options and Outlook Express is currently set as
the default e-mail program. I have IE and Firefox installed on this machine.
